Unveiling the Current State and Strategic Imperatives Shaping UHF Handheld Radios as Core Enablers of Modern Critical Communication Networks
The current communications landscape is witnessing an unprecedented convergence of reliability, performance, and digital augmentation in UHF handheld radios. Historically rooted in analog voice transmission, these devices are now evolving into integral nodes within broader critical communications networks. Organizations across public safety, utilities, transportation, and manufacturing are placing greater emphasis on resilient push-to-talk solutions that can seamlessly interface with data networks, ensuring mission-critical voice and information remain accessible under any circumstances. Recent data indicate that digital mobile radio technologies, particularly DMR platforms, are experiencing rapid adoption due to their superior audio clarity, enhanced encryption, and the ability to carry data alongside voice in a single channel; these factors are fundamental to operators seeking enhanced situational awareness and operational efficiency.
Transitioning from standalone voice services to integrated data-driven ecosystems, industry stakeholders are placing emphasis on features such as real-time location tracking, intelligent noise cancellation, and modular form factors designed for extreme environments. This focus on operational intelligence is matched by the growing integration of IoT capabilities, enabling UHF radios to serve as gateways for sensor data and remote diagnostics. Such developments are propelling a gradual shift in procurement priorities, with end-users increasingly valuing interoperability, future-proof upgrade paths, and ecosystem synergies over purely hardware-centric specifications.
Moreover, the resurgence of investment in public infrastructure modernization across key economies is catalyzing renewed demand for two-way radio systems that can scale across multiple agencies and support hybrid digital-analog operations. While cost efficiency remains a priority, decision-makers are now balancing total cost of ownership considerations with the imperative for cybersecurity resilience, driving a wave of RFPs that emphasize end-to-end encryption and standardized compliance frameworks.

Assessing the Layered Effects of 2025 United States Tariff Policies on UHF Handheld Radio Supply Chains Cost Structures and Market Accessibility
The introduction of layered U.S. tariff measures in early 2025 has exerted significant pressure on the cost structures of UHF handheld radio devices and their components. A universal 10% reciprocal tariff on all imported goods, reinstated in May, augmented existing duties and compounded expenses for radios manufactured abroad. Concurrently, a 30% tariff on goods originating from China further elevated the landed cost of modules, enclosures, and specialized electronics sourced from major OEM supply chains, creating a bifurcated sourcing dynamic that incentivizes both re-shoring and diversification into alternate manufacturing hubs.
In addition to product-specific levies, the imposition of 25% duties on steel and aluminum since March has directly impacted metal enclosures and antenna assemblies, driving material cost surcharges that ripple through distributor pricing models. Key industry suppliers such as Icom and Motorola have publicly announced incremental price increases ranging from 7% to 24% across their handheld radio portfolios, reflecting the need to preserve margin integrity amid escalating import costs.
The cumulative effect of these tariff actions has prompted end-users and channel partners to reevaluate procurement timelines, favoring inventory acceleration or alternative sourcing strategies to mitigate near-term budgetary impacts. Forward-looking organizations are now actively exploring partnerships with domestic fabricators and leveraging temporary exemptions where applicable, aiming to sustain deployment schedules without compromising on performance or regulatory compliance. As trade policy continues to evolve, decision-makers will need to account for both direct import duties and ancillary logistical disruptions driven by evolving customs processes.
Deriving Actionable Intelligence from Detailed End Use Technology Power Output and Distribution Channel Segmentation of the UHF Handheld Radio Market
Insight into market segmentation reveals distinct growth drivers that each demand tailored strategic approaches. End use applications in hospitality and retail are being reshaped by demand for guest and shopper engagement solutions, while transportation operators seek robust, vehicle-mountable radios for fleet coordination across aviation, land logistics, and marine operations. Within manufacturing environments, UHF radios are critical for just-in-time workflows and safety incidents, particularly in automotive production lines, chemical plants, and electronics assembly operations. Public safety organizations continue to prioritize interoperability and encryption for seamless incident response across police, fire, and EMS teams, while utilities players in energy, telecommunications, and water sectors balance coverage reliability with network resilience.
From a technology standpoint, the analog-to-digital migration remains a key inflection point. Analog Fm and Pm offerings continue to serve cost-sensitive deployments where voice-only clarity suffices, yet digital protocols such as Dmr, P25, and Tetra are capturing share due to their capacity for data integration, spectrum efficiency, and enhanced security features. Power output considerations further diversify the competitive landscape, as high-power radios extend reach in remote or industrial zones, medium-power units strike a balance for general coverage needs, and low-power devices optimize battery life for prolonged field operations.
Distribution channels also reflect evolving buyer preferences. Direct sales teams increasingly emphasize consultative selling models and bundled service agreements, distributor networks offer localized inventory and technical support, and online sales platforms are catering to rapid deployment cycles and smaller-scale end users. Recognizing these segmentation nuances allows industry participants to position differentiated offerings, align value propositions with specific customer pain points, and foresee emerging pockets of demand within an otherwise mature market.

Analyzing Regional Variations in Demand Infrastructure Readiness Regulatory Frameworks and End User Adoption Across Major Global Markets for UHF Handheld Radios
Regional analysis underscores how structural factors shape market maturity and expansion trajectories. In the Americas, substantial investments in public safety modernization programs and the FirstNet broadband push have accelerated the shift toward digital UHF solutions, with law enforcement and emergency services frequently upgrading to P25 Phase 2 units to ensure nationwide interoperability. Additionally, commercial verticals such as retail and manufacturing in North America demonstrate a growing appetite for hybrid analog-digital radios that can integrate with cloud-based dispatch and workforce management platforms.
In Europe, Middle East & Africa, the diversity of regulatory regimes and spectrum allocation frameworks introduces both opportunities and challenges. Western Europe’s coordinated spectrum strategies facilitate multi-country deployments of digital protocols, while Gulf states are investing heavily in smart city and critical infrastructure projects that demand resilient communications. At the same time, parts of Africa remain in earlier stages of analog-to-digital transition, driven by budget constraints and legacy network considerations. These varied maturity levels necessitate flexible product portfolios capable of supporting mixed deployments with minimal integration overhead.
Asia-Pacific encapsulates a spectrum of adoption patterns-from highly advanced markets in Japan and South Korea, where digital radio integration with IoT and 5G networks is converging fast, to emerging economies in Southeast Asia where two-way radio remains a vital communication backbone for logistics, mining, and resource extraction sectors. Governments in India and Australia have launched initiatives to upgrade mission-critical radio networks for public safety and transit, spotlighting the need for cost-effective, modular devices that can be rapidly scaled across wide geographies.

Profiling Leading Market Participants Their Strategic Initiatives Partnerships and Innovation Roadmaps that Shape the UHF Handheld Radio Competitive Ecosystem
A landscape dominated by established entities and innovative challengers shapes the competitive dynamics of the UHF handheld radio industry. Motorola Solutions remains at the forefront, leveraging its extensive portfolio of analog and digital devices along with integrated software platforms for network management and cloud-based PTT. Its emphasis on end-to-end solutions, including radio dispatch consoles and vehicle-mounted repeaters, solidifies leadership in public safety and enterprise sectors.
Icom and JVCKENWOOD continue to differentiate through product reliability, modular accessory ecosystems, and user-centric ergonomics tailored for professional users in utilities and transportation. Both vendors have publicly adjusted pricing to absorb tariff-driven cost pressures while accelerating R&D investments in low-power, high-efficiency transceivers. Kenwood’s strategic collaborations with telematics providers and cloud-based dispatch services underscore a pivot toward software-enabled revenue models.
New entrants and regional specialists such as Hytera, Tait Communications, and Uniden Holdings are capitalizing on niche segments by offering competitive pricing and localized support services. Hytera’s expansions into smart city projects and Tait’s focus on rugged rail and mining applications illustrate the importance of specialized value propositions in capturing non-traditional market pockets. Collectively, these participants are driving continuous innovation through software-defined hardware, advanced encryption suites, and ecosystem partnerships, ensuring that the broader UHF handheld radio value chain remains agile and responsive.
